Dead mouse

Someone in the office came upon a bunch of old computer stuff, which they took over to me to identify. Among the junk was this jewel of computer accessories, the Apple Pro Mouse. Not a lot of computer mice actually pull off 'sexy', but this one did. The entire mouse is a button, but it works perfectly, with no missed clicks. Despite being a one-button no-scrollwheel-having oddity, I resolved to make it my primary pointing device, even though I'm on Windows at work, but sadly, it's near death. It identifies as a USB device, then dies. Then appears, then dies. The mighty mouse is okay, but this is truly one of Apple's triumphs.

Mapleshade wants your money

I'm not sure why this catalog arrived at our house, but I spent a good 45 minutes reading it last night and getting mad at it. They are purveyors of "audiophile" equipment, such as brass discs that you place on top of your CD player for superior sound, $500 RCA cables, wooden platforms that make your speakers sound like you spent $1000 more than you did on them, and CD spray that unleashes the music held within. I'm not sure why audiophile equipment has to so blatantly fly in the face of accepted science, but if you want to read more on their insane claims or purchase some of their overpriced snake oil, do so at mapleshaderecords.com. Enjoy your warmer, fuller sound, and unleash the true potential of your $100,000 audio setup.
